Diaz v. Bell
Petitioner: Miguel Diaz
Respondent: Superintendent Eric Bell
Case Number: 9:2021cv00610
Filed: May 26, 2021
Court: US District Court for the Northern District of New York
Presiding Judge: Mae A D'Agostino
Nature of Suit: Habeas Corpus (General)
Cause of Action: 28 U.S.C. ยง 2254 Petition for Writ of Habeas Corpus (State)
Jury Demanded By: None

Date Filed Document Text
June 25, 2021 Case transferred from New York Northern has been opened in Southern District of New York as case 1:21-cv-05452, filed 06/22/2021. (jmb)
June 21, 2021 Filing 5 DECISION AND ORDER: It is ORDERED that this action is transferred to the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York; and it is further ORDERED that the Clerk is directed to electronically transfer this action to the Clerk of the Southern District of New York. The Court hereby waives the fourteen (14) day waiting period provided for in Local Rule 3.7. Signed by U.S. District Judge Mae A. D'Agostino on 6/21/2021. (Copy served via regular mail)(meb)
June 21, 2021 Case transferred electronically to District of Southern New York pursuant to Order of Transfer dated 6/21/2021. (meb)
June 14, 2021 Filing 4 TEXT ORDER REOPENING CASE: This action was administratively closed due to petitioner's failure to comply with the filing fee requirements, and petitioner was directed to respond to the Order if s/he wished to pursue this action. Petitioner has now responded. The Clerk is directed to reopen this action and restore it to the Court's active docket. Authorized by U.S. District Judge Mae A. D'Agostino on 6/14/2021. (Copy served via regular mail)(meb)
June 14, 2021 Filing 3 Letter enclosing the filing fee filed by Miguel Diaz. (Mailing envelope included) (meb)
June 14, 2021 Filing fee received: $5.00, receipt number SYR059378. (meb)
May 28, 2021 Opinion or Order Filing 2 ORDER Directing Administrative Closure with Opportunity to Comply with Filing Fee Requirement. It is hereby ORDERED that because this action was not properly commenced, the Clerk is directed to administratively close this action; and it is further ORDERED that if petitioner wants to pursue this action, he must so notify the Court WITHIN THIRTY (30) DAYS of the filing date of this Order and either: (1) pay the court's filing fee of five dollars ($5.00); or (2) submit a completed and signed IFP Application that has been certified by an appropriate prison official at his facility; and it is further ORDERED that upon petitioner's compliance with this order, the Clerk shall reopen this action and forward it to the Court for review; and it is further ORDERED that the Clerk serve a copy of this Order on petitioner along with a blank IFP Application. Signed by U.S. District Judge Mae A. D'Agostino on May 28, 2021. (Copy served via regular mail on the petitioner along with a blank IFP Application).(rep)
May 26, 2021 Filing 1 PETITION: For Writ of Habeas Corpus, filed by Miguel Diaz. (Attachments: #1 Mailing Envelope)(rep)
